“This trip covers two of the three main touring areas of Guatemala, the highlands in the south and the Peten area (Mayan sites) in the north. It is run by the tour operator's local partners, with a high standard in vehicles, drivers and guides. The highlands segment (6 days) was excellent - the itinerary is varied and includes some very interesting places not commonly covered on other tours in this area. There is also a good amount of free time in lovely Antigua, so that you can fit in the Pacaya volcano trip (half day, either morning or afternoon) as an option. The Peten section was executed by another one of WE's local partners and it visits the fabulous Mayan sites of Tikal and Yaxha. We were not so impressed with the third site, Ceibal. Accommodation standard is generally very good, and the Barcelo in Guatemala is a lovely base, the Hotel Camino Real Tikal in Peten, is a lovely resort hotel and convenient to Tikal and Yaxha, but 40 minutes from Flores.”
